I attended my second con this past year, and, all in all, I had a great time. Staying at the hotel, while expensive, has it's added incentives ... the least of which being an exclusive toy. This past year it was the RID Prowl to Sunstreaker repaint, this year is the Mega Zarak repaint of Armada Megatron. Also, by staying there, you can easily go up to your room at any time during the day between panels and such, as sometimes, the day does get quite long.

 

Then there is added incentive of a real community feeling .. just being around other fans. The buzz can get quite electric, especially before, during, and after the Hasbro panel. Parts trading parties, fan events with the sites/boards (which there are even MORE of this year, and TFans will be amongst those involved!), the Transgeneration party on Saturday night (which gets a new room this year, bigger than last years, more prizes, TFans will be involved in this as well), and all the panels and such.

 

Venture down to the bar on any night and you are likely to find your community buddies and members of the TF world such as Gary Chalk, David Kaye, Simon Furman, the guys from dreamwave kicking back with a drink or two or at the pool table. Trust me ... don't challenge Chalk. The guy can be three sheets in the wind and still beat any fan in attendance at pool. I know. I think I still have marks from that beating.

 

There can be some things that go wrong, such, as the plates not arriving for the dinner last year, etc ... but as far as fan experiences and the "live" community, it's a nice time.
